How do you adjust the angle of the light once installed and the bumper is on? Can you reach down inside with the hood open? Can it be done from underneath with the skid plate removed? Or do you just set it before putting the bumper on and hope it's good?
Based on my experience with the CaliRaised kit on my '16 Tacoma and what i'm seeing looking behind the grill and in the install video (below), there isn't going to be room to adjust after installation without removing at least the skid plate...more realistically the bumper.

As i did with my Taco, i'm going to point the bar level as possible and use a touch of blue loctite on the light bar mounting bolts. I had the prior kit on from 2017 until i sold the truck (June 2025) and it never moved. Hopefully this one will be the same.

Good news! Toyota was able to clear almost all of the codes beside the front radar. The tech was able to determine that the connector was not completely seated. Irregardless, my $40 Amazon obd2 scanner would not have been able to clear the codes.

With that, the connectors that need to be disconnected when removing the front bumper are extremely temperamental and be sure to be very careful connecting/disconnecting.

The installation of the lightbar itself was super easy and wiring using the factory aux system with the provided pigtails was even easier. Will test the light more at night but I’m very happy now that the warning lights are off!
